To effectively manage condensation from the furnace and prevent damage while ensuring optimal performance, it is important to regularly inspect and clean the condensate drain line, ensure proper insulation on the pipes to prevent freezing, and maintain proper airflow around the furnace to prevent condensation buildup. Additionally, installing a condensate pump or a dehumidifier can help manage excess moisture. Regular maintenance and monitoring of the furnace system can help prevent issues related to condensation.
Condensation on a furnace can be prevented or managed effectively by ensuring proper ventilation, maintaining consistent temperature levels, and using a dehumidifier if necessary. Regular maintenance of the furnace and its components can also help prevent condensation buildup.
Condensation on pipes can be prevented or managed effectively by insulating the pipes with foam or other insulating materials to keep them at a consistent temperature. Additionally, ensuring proper ventilation and air circulation in the area can help reduce humidity levels and prevent condensation from forming.
Condensation on AC lines can be prevented or managed effectively by properly insulating the lines to reduce temperature differences, ensuring proper ventilation and airflow around the lines, and maintaining the AC system regularly to prevent any leaks or issues that could lead to excess moisture buildup.
